LIUNA AND NPMHU URGE CONGRESS TO REJECT MISGUIDED PLAN

Once again, Republican leaders in the House of Representatives have unveiled a proposal that displays their overt hostility to the U.S. Postal Service, its customers (more commonly known as the American public), and all postal employees. This latest, misguided proposal would make monies available to the highway construction trust fund by cutting postal services.


To be sure, Congress needs to fund the Highway Trust Fund before the end of August, in order to ensure continued funding for thousands of crucial projects aimed at repairing and improving our nation’s infrastructure. But the Postal Service also is a vital component of the American economy, and taking money from one need to fund another is simply an accounting gimmick that has no place when trying to make rational legislative decisions.

NATIONAL ARBITRATION PENDING ON BLOOD PLATELET LEAVE

On March 10, 2014, the National parties held an arbitration hearing over the following question: whether the Memorandum of Understanding (MOU) between the Postal Service and the NPMHU on Administrative Leave for Bone Marrow, Stem Cell, Blood Platelet, and Organ Donations guarantees fulltime employees administrative leave in eight-hour increments when a request for administrative leave to donate blood platelets is approved?
